Jane Kahlich
Jane Kahlich was born to Jessie Faye (Dunlap) and Ralph Henry Kahlich on December 11, 1946 at Mercy Hospital in Slaton, Texas. Jane’s parents both served in World War II and passed down their hard work ethic and strong Christian faith to both Jane and her sister, Cindy. On August 25, 1966, Jane was married to David Allen Archer in Denton, Texas. Their children are Anthony Shayne (1969), Bridgett Danelle (1970 stillborn), and Tricia Jan (1972). In 1980, Jane and David divorced, but Jane carried on as a courageous single mother, raising her two children to work hard and fear God. She also showed them how to fight through hard times and to have fun living life. After another short marriage and divorce, Jane was single for the rest of her life, focusing her attention on her children and grandchildren. She remained in and around Dallas & Fort Worth working as a receptionist at several businesses in the area until her retirement in January 2014 when she went to live with her son, Shayne. Jane was incredibly proud of her children and loved watching the rapid growth of her eight grandchildren (Ray, John, Julianna, D.J., Chelsey, Brent, Jesse, and Angel) and her four great grandchildren (Hannah, Logan, Hailey, and Paisley), who all call her Nanny. While the family is devastated at her sudden loss, we are all proud of the way she lived her life and we are prepared to strengthen her legacy in the future. WE LOVE YOU MOM!
